Citylink the Russian trade is a discounter network, part of the Group of Companies. Merlion On the market since 2008. As of November 2022, the company has about 900 stores and points of delivery of goods in 400 cities. Russia

2021: Growth in turnover by 26% to 175 billion rubles

Citylink, which works in the field, on e-commerce February 21, 2022 shared TAdviser financial with the operational results for 2021. The Company continued to increase its turnover, while expanding its geographical presence and increasing expertise in product categories. At the end of the year, its trade turnover increased by 26% compared to the previous year and amounted to 175 billion. In rubles 2021, Citylink issued more than 13.8 million orders.

Citylink's turnover grew by 26%
Photo: socium-sokol.ru

The main task of Citylink remains the same - to support the growth of the Russian e-commerce market and be a useful service for both retail customers and corporate clients. In 2021, the daily audience of the Internet site at its peak amounted to more than 2.3 million people, and the number of active corporate clients increased to 253 thousand.

The company also continued to expand its presence in cities across Russia. At the end of 2021, 1,069 points were opened in 500 cities of Russia in all 8 federal districts. In 2021, the retail and warehouse network grew 1.5 times to 253 thousand square meters, and the total area of ​ ​ all objects is 400 thousand square meters. meters.

In 2021, 5 new objects of large formats were opened with an assortment of more than 35 thousand product items in stock. Now residents,,, and Saratov St. Petersburg Volgograd Omsk Chelyabinsk will be able to access the widest range of goods in their city. The company also opened full-length stores in the Far East for the first time.

The leading cities in terms of growth dynamics year-on-year were Petrozavodsk, Ulan-Ude, Novokuznetsk, Angarsk, Novokuybyshevsk, which showed an increase in turnover by 8-10 times due to the opening of new points and the expansion of the range in the region.

In November 2021, Citylink opened a logistics hub in St. Petersburg with an area of ​ ​ 14 thousand square meters to expand the range and make faster delivery in the North-West region. In total, the company uses 4 logistics hubs with a total area of ​ ​ more than 138 thousand square meters: in the Moscow region, in Rostov-on-Don, St. Petersburg and Yekaterinburg. In 2022, the company intends to double its logistics capacity.

As of February 2022, about 150 thousand commodity items are presented at the Citylinka site. The online retailer plans to expand the range to 1 million product items, opening new categories and filling the range of existing ones.

The top categories in terms of sales in 2021 were "Laptops and Computers," "Mobile Communications and Tablets" and "Components and Server Equipment," "TV," "Office Equipment and Peripherals."

According to the data, GFK every sixth laptop in 2021 Russia was sold by Citylink. The most popular product was Sylvamo Svetocopy paper, which was bought more than 115 thousand times, and in buyers' checks most often (47 thousand times) there were SSD Kingston SATA III 240Gb drives.

In 2021, Citylink significantly expanded its range. Trade turnover in new categories increased 2.8 times compared to the previous year. The largest increase in demand was recorded in the categories "Sportinventar" (7 times), "Wheels and wheels" (6 times), as well as 2.5 times increased categories FMCG and children's goods. In 2021, categories were also launched - "Auto Parts," "Construction Materials," "Plumbing," "Fishing," which from the start showed very high growth rates.

In the past year, Citylink launched a mobile application, which at the start was installed by more than 487 thousand people. The application is another element of the Citylinka platform, which involves multi-format and multi-channel purchases, and will also become another channel for expert responses to customers - it will include responses from manufacturers of goods, technology consultants and the expert community.

Information technologies at Citylinka

2019: Adapting the site for mobile devices using AMP technology

On December 27, 2019, Citylink revealed that he had adapted the site's promotion for mobile devices using AMP technology. integration Thanks to Citylink, he increased conversions to purchase from organic issuance. search engine Google According to the to data curator of the project, SEO-area expert Citylink Yuri Kalashnikov, the conversion rate on AMP pages compared to the version of the site for mobile devices in November increased by 33%.

The integration decision is related to a change in the priority of indexing in the Google search engine from July 1, 2019 - with a focus on mobile content (mobile-first). To maintain a high level of sales and conversion, the company switched from a mobile version of the site based on SPA (Single Page Application) to an adaptive (responsive) solution, which allowed to increase the coverage of the site pages for mobile users.

Start rebranding

Retailer Citylink on September 28, 2021 announced the start of rebranding. The changes will be implemented in stages and will affect the visual style of the brand, promotional communications and positioning. The company carried out the last redesign of the logo and corporate identity in 2016.

Citylink's strategy combines expertise, automation, accuracy, honesty and empathy in communication with customers. The company aims to use the symbiosis of human experience and technology accuracy to provide the audience with objective and understandable information at all stages of contact with the retailer.

"Since its inception, our company has sought to provide consumers with quality products at affordable prices based on the current needs of the audience. Citylink is more than a technology and electronics store, we are developing into a multi-category platform, striving to share expertise with the buyer through all communication channels, adapt complex technical terminology to a simple, understandable language, bring services and services to the most comfortable level of interaction, - said Mikhail Slavinsky, CEO of Citylink. - The evolution of the company, the transformation of the market and the expansion of the audience of buyers inspired us to carry out rebranding. It was important for us to preserve the identity of the brand and fill it with more accurate associations. We have a lot of work that has already begun. "

The retailer has updated the logo to a more minimalistic and concise one: the hand with the finger pointing to the button has been changed by a frame with the letter "C," which symbolizes the screen of a smartphone, computer or laptop. The updated logo has already replaced the previous version on the retailer's website. The brand's color palette has transformed, adding cold white, gray-blue and deep dark blue to the company's traditional orange color. The updated palette will be gradually introduced into all online and offline communication channels of the company over the year.

In an effort to create an expert community of the company and an audience, Citylink is increasing the number of communication channels. The retailer has launched its online magazine, where network specialists tell you how to choose and use equipment, answer important questions and test gadgets. Video content with unpacking of new products, tips for choosing devices and unusual experiences is available on the brand's pages in the video hosting YouTube and service. TikTok

The company's product portfolio, in addition to equipment and, electronic engineers was replenished with the following trading groups: auto goods, children's goods, garden and summer cottage home goods, goods from sport the "and rest" category, bathroom furniture, plumbing, electricians and heating. The range will continue to expand.

Sberbank aims to buy Merlion's retail assets at a price of more than $1 billion while its top managers are behind bars

Sberbank is seriously interested in acquiring the retail assets of the Merlion group of companies, including the online retailer Citylink, which is part of it. To this end, at the end of 2020, Sberbank has already conducted a pre-sale audit of Merlion, Kommersant reported, citing its own sources[1] of [2].

According to the surveyed experts, such a deal, tentatively estimated at more than $1 billion, will be able to provide Sberbank with a significant strengthening of its positions in the e-commerce sector to strengthen competition with Yandex.Market, Ozon and Wildberries.

In November 2020, CNews said that co-owners of Merlion Vladislav Mangutov, Oleg Karchev, Alexey Abramov and top manager Boris Levin were under arrest after a denunciation of a participant in hostilities in Donbass. For Merlion, according to experts, a deal with Sberbank would help support the company amid a criminal case against its top managers.

Sberbank declined to comment on the possible acquisition of assets, Merlion said there were no negotiations on the sale of assets and an assessment of the financial condition of the company, Kommersant said.

Launch of distribution center in Rostov-on-Don

Logo "Citylink" in 2020.

The network of electronics and household appliances stores Citylink continues to implement its logistics strategy and launches a distribution center in Rostov-on-Don with an area of ​ ​ more than 12,000 sq.m. This was reported to Citylinka on July 15, 2020. It is expected that the facility will speed up the delivery of orders for residents of the southern regions of Russia and expand the range of goods available for receipt in a short time.

According to Citylinka's calculations, the opening of the facility will create more than 150 jobs in Rostov-on-Don at the first stage alone. Taking into account the dynamic development of the company and the active increase in the share in the cities of the region, the number of jobs will increase. The distribution center will process orders with goods from world manufacturers of electronics and household appliances, which are part of the company's portfolio. In total, as of July 2020, it has more than 800 brands and 70 thousand items of goods.

The capacity and space of the distribution center will also be used to store the goods of the company's partners, connected according to the model of partner warehouses, which provides for the integration of information systems for data exchange.

Thanks to the organization of the distributed storage model, delivery times to customers in the cities of the region will be reduced by at least 30 hours.

Turnover increased by 27.6% to 102.8 billion rubles

On April 15, 2020, Citylink told TAdviser that the turnover for the financial year increased by 27.6% and amounted to 102.8 billion rubles (including VAT).

Citylink turnover exceeded 100 billion rubles

Site traffic grew by 40%, reaching 1,500,000 sessions per day. The increase in the number of orders was 31%.

The positive dynamics of key indicators remains due to continuous work in all business areas. This includes expanding geography, developing the product portfolio and introducing additional services, automating and increasing the efficiency of business processes, expanding and updating the tools for working with clients, and implementing special activities.

For the fiscal year, the company opened 43 additional stores and 133 pick-up points. Increased the area of ​ ​ rented spaces in points of the network with high traffic by 22%. This made it possible to strengthen the presence in cities with dynamically growing demand and ensure representation in other cities, reduce the delivery time of popular goods.

The product portfolio was replenished with 89 brands, including Erisson,, Realme,, Vivo Oppo Clevercel and others. The range has expanded due to the introduction of additional product groups, as well as the connection of partner warehouses. As of April 2020, the company's portfolio includes about 800 brands of world manufacturers and 70,000 items of goods in stock.

The company continued to expand sales channels, connect and develop tools for customer convenience. The chain's stores were equipped with modern electronic terminals for prompt re-purchase of goods on the spot. The company's online store on the Tmall site and a paperless online lending service have been launched. For corporate clients, the electronic document management option is connected.

To increase sales, Citylink adapted the site's promotion for mobile devices using Google's AMP technology. The search engine and filter system on the site have become more convenient.

The first federal advertising campaign on television was implemented.

The comprehensive approach contributed to strong sales dynamics across all key commodity categories during the fiscal year. Growth in the category "Mobile communications" amounted to 48%, in the category "Laptops, tablets and accessories" 29.8%, in the category "Computers and components" 13.3%; "Monitors" 36.7%; "Office equipment" 31.1%; "Large household appliances" 29.4%; "Household appliances" 28.6%; "Home Digital Technology" 21.6%. Furniture sales rose 91.8%. Modern gadgets were especially popular: the demand for smart speakers increased 8 times, for fitness bracelets - 2.5 times.

Sales of services (warranty, insurance, delivery, lending, PC assembly, installation of equipment, etc.) increased by 45.5%.

In addition, the company continued to develop the direction of ensuring the issuance of shipments of partners. In 2019, logistics operator Pony Express joined Citylink's infrastructure. Partners DPD and Pick Point connected additional stores and points of issue of the company.

The company showed positive dynamics of indicators against the background of a slowdown in the growth rate of the retail market. Thus, in the segment of electronics and household appliances, the market slowed down from 18% in 2018 to 5% in 2019, in the segment of online sales - from 35% in 2018 to 21% in 2019.

Empowering a customer's personal account at self-service kiosks

Electronic discounter Citylink on August 23, 2019 announced the expansion of the omnichannel model of interaction with buyers using the function of self-service kiosks. Customers will now be able to use all the capabilities of their personal account not only from familiar devices - a smartphone or PC, but also through network terminals. From August 23, this technology can be tested in the 11th Citylink store in Moscow, located in the Bakuninsky business center. Then the function will become available throughout the network.

Now the buyer in offline stores has the opportunity to check the cart and previously viewed items of the assortment, open a purchase history, issue and track his order. The updated scenario for working with the device expands the optional capabilities of the terminal, improves the convenience of purchases and the speed of receiving an order. With the advent of access to the personal account, the visitor can manage positions from the entire discounter assortment.

To ensure security, users are offered several options for accessing their personal account. In addition to the classic method through a login and password, there is a variation with two-factor authentication (the system sends an SMS code with a one-time login password to the phone number specified by the buyer), as well as the ability to access using a QR code. The terminal is becoming autonomous, safe and convenient for both inexperienced and advanced customers, according to Citylinka.

In addition, the capabilities of the updated software made it possible to consolidate information about the current orders of the buyer, regardless of the access point - contacting the call center, through the site, its mobile version or using the terminal. This helps to speed up the processes of serving the consumer, processing orders.

Launch of ESD electronic key sales service for b2b customers

Electronic discounter "Citylink," an Internet retailer of digital and household appliances, on March 25, 2019 announced the launch of a service for the sale of electronic keys using the ESD (Electronic Software Distribution) model - a modern channel for the supply of software products online - for corporate clients.

In general, the ESD model complemented traditional distribution channels for box, corporate and OEM licenses. On March 25, Citylink offers this model. ON Microsoft The ESD key is transferred via a e-mail link to download the distribution kit and its serial number. Licenses are ready for installation immediately after receiving an electronic key and are completely equivalent in functionality to boxed versions of the software. One of the main advantages of ESD technology is the delivery time - the buyer can use the software product in a few minutes after making payment, the discounter emphasized. There are also no restrictions on the timing of activation. Information about purchased licenses is available to Citylink customers in their personal account in a special section "Electronic licenses and subscriptions."

Testing in Moscow the possibility of paying for purchases from a sales assistant

On March 4, 2019, Citylink announced that it plans to open 19 offline stores in Moscow with a total area of ​ ​ more than 15,000 square meters. m Thus, by mid-2020, the total number of outlets located in the capital will reach 26 stores. The volume of investments in the implementation of this project will amount to about 620 million rubles.

The next opening of a free-standing (street retail) store is scheduled for March 4 (28 Narodnogo Militia St. 1). In this store, an experimental service model will be applied, which is aimed at optimizing the customer's time from the moment the product is ordered to receipt. It will be possible to pay for the purchase from a consultant seller, bypassing separate cash zones. In the future, it is also planned to connect the opportunity to make payments through the terminal, which as of March 4, 2019 is used to select the product on the spot.

Despite the growth of online sales (+ 30% compared to the previous period), the company is actively increasing its presence in offline, developing the formats of warehouse stores and points of issue.

One of the priority regions for the development of the company's presence is Moscow. The large-scale expansion of Citylink in the capital's market involves the opening of 17 stores in the midi format and 2 smart outlets over the year. The strategy of choosing locations implies, first of all, the choice of retail space in those areas where the retailer was not previously present; such indicators as the traffic potential of the shopping center, transport accessibility, commercial conditions, etc. are also taken into account.

2018

The company's total revenue for 2018 amounted to 77.4 billion rubles

On February 18, 2019, the Citylink electronic discounter, one of the digital and Internetretailers household appliances, reported the results of its activities in 2018. The company's total revenue increased by 29%, amounting to 77.4 billion rubles (including). VAT Online sales grew by 30%, reaching 73.2 billion rubles.

Citylink's total revenue increased by 29% over the year

Citylink recorded an increase in indicators in all regions: the turnover of structural units responsible for development in the Central Federal District increased by 28%, in the Northwestern Federal District - by 35%, in the Siberian Federal District - by 60%, in the Volga Federal District - by 25%, in the Federal District - by 30%, in the Southern Federal District - by 21%, in the North Caucasus Federal District - by 23%.

In 2018, compared to the same period in 2017, the amount of the average retail purchase check at Citylink increased by 1.5% and amounted to 6900 rubles. Its largest value was recorded in the Southern Federal District - about 7,000 rubles.

In 2018, Citylink expanded its assortment due to the development of a portfolio of additional brands, the total number of which reached 750 (+ 50). The company has increased the number of items available for receipt in more than 330 cities of the Russian Federation - up to 65,000 (+ 10,000).

The most significant share in the turnover in 2018 (about 70%) was sales of common goods from various manufacturers from the categories of computer, digital and household appliances: laptops (growth was 42%), cell phones (+ 32%), TVs/plasma panels (+ 39%), computers (+ 55%), LCD monitors (+ 24%), components (+ 30%), laser MFPs (+ 44%), tablets (+ 13%), monoblocks (+ 80%), washing machines (+ 55%) and refrigerators (+ 40%).

A number of product areas showed significant growth dynamics: headphones and headsets, as well as smart home products, showed double growth, sales of media players and Smart TV consoles increased 2.5 times, sales of game consoles, mini-photo printers and split systems increased three times - 6 and 8 times, respectively.

Among other goods, sales of furniture, in particular chairs and chairs (+ 75%), computer tables (2 times), leather goods (2.2 times), printing paper (3 times), grew most actively.

Among the services in 2018, insurance (an increase of 2 times), digital services (an increase of 2.2 times) developed the most actively.

In 2018, the Internet retailer also increased the volume of issuing third-party orders, adding two partners - Pick Point, DPD (the company also cooperates with Ozon.ru). The total number of orders was 350,000, which is 3.5 times higher than the value of 2017 period. Profits rose 4.5 times.

The company continued to expand the presence of physical points in both large and small cities. Along with the increase in points of issue for the year, 45 stores-warehouses of three formats were opened - "maxi," "midi," "smart," including in Moscow, St. Petersburg, Nizhny Novgorod and other cities. The format of all stores assumes the presence of a warehouse, which occupies about 80% of the area, self-service terminals and delivery windows are presented in the trading floor.

During 2018, Citylink conducted technological re-equipment projects aimed at improving the efficiency of processes that affect both pricing policy and service. In particular, he modernized analytical software, transferred a contact center to an omnichannel platform, and updated self-service terminals.

Replenishment of the network with 600 DPD Pickup points

On November 21, 2018, one of the Internetretailers digital and household appliances and other goods, the Citylink electronic discounter, announced a strategic partnership with the express delivery company. DPD in Russia

The companies plan to develop cooperation in two areas. First logistic provider , it will connect Citylink-mini to the DPD Pickup network, expanding the geographical availability of its services for recipients. In the future, Citylink will begin distributing goods from its assortment through DPD Pickup points. During the year, the discounter will add at least 600 partner points to its network.

Interaction implies integration IT systems of companies for high quality and speed of execution of orders. DPD developed interface software for automatic exchange, and data Citylink adapted business processes in the information system and refined its functionality. Automation has enabled partners to manage ordering and shipping in a single interface, eliminating human error.

In November 2018, the first PVZs of the Internet retailer in six cities of the Russian Federation were connected to the DPD Pickup network. In the near future, more than 50 Citylink-mini points will begin to issue partner orders. Connection of Citylink points in 330 cities will be completed in 2019.

The second stage of cooperation will allow the discounter to expand the geography of Internet sales and delivery of digital, computer, household appliances, garden electronics, automotive gadgets, furniture and office of Russian and foreign brands from April 2019 by integrating DPD Pickup points in remote regions of the Russian Federation into its structure.

2016: Share of service products in total network turnover increased by 2 times

In the first half of this year, the economic situation in the country somewhat stabilized, and the buyer was able to form a new consumption model. This provided most major online retailers with increased sales. Already in February, Citylink's turnover grew by 33% compared to February 2015. Consistently positive dynamics began to be traced across all key commodity categories. For example, in the first half of this year, the commodity category "Computers and components" compared to the same period last year increased by 46% in money and by 23% in pieces; in the category "Laptops, tablets and accessories" growth was 27% (in money) and 10% (in pieces); in the category "Mobile communications" - 31% (in money) and 20% (in pieces); "Large household appliances" - 10% (in money) and 15% (in pieces); "Monitors" - 53% (in money) and 23% (in pieces).

And the first 6 months of the year, the share of service products in the total turnover of the network increased 2 times. Sales growth in quantitative terms for the same period also amounted to 2 times. At the same time, sales increased in all service categories. In particular, in the "Computer Assembly" category, sales in units increased by more than 72%, and in "Digital Services" - by 1.3 times. In the 2nd quarter of 2016, there was an explosive growth in the Insurance category - 2.5 times compared to the corresponding period last year.

In April 2016, the electronic discounter entered a new region - the Republic of Bashkortostan, opening a full-length store-warehouse in Ufa. The retailer also strengthened its presence in the regions by opening 9 new points of issue and order (PVZ) of Citylink-mini in 7 Russian cities.

As of 2016, the retailer's assortment includes more than 52,000 items of goods, about 700 world brands. Citylink is represented in 18 federal districts of the Russian Federation and in 195 cities of Russia. The network unites 27 full-format e-commerce centers and more than 270 points of issue and order of Citylink-mini goods.

2015: Network turnover - 36.5 billion rubles

The network turnover in 2015 amounted to 36.5 billion rubles (including VAT); the share of online sales in revenue - 88%; number of visits per www.citilink.ru per day - 355,000 people; 1 million registered users on the site. 21% of buyers visiting the Internet resource from different devices give 50% of the profit.

According to the Analytical Department of Citylink, in 2015 the volume of Russian Internet trade grew by only 10% and reached 780 billion rubles (only the commodity segment, including the cross-border), and the BTiE segment fell by 7-10%.
